Lehet, hogy a cronnak nincs jogosultsága írni/olvasni a /root-ot?
Sücy
From: techinfo-boun...@lista.sulinet.hu
[mailto:techinfo-boun...@lista.sulinet.hu] On Behalf Of István Bálint
Sent: Thursday, January 09, 2014 8:48 AM
To: Techinfo
Subject: linux script e-mailben
Van egy linux-script:
Van egy linux-script:
#!/bin/bash
pflogsumm -d yesterday /var/log/mail.log /root/pfstat
cat /root/pfstat | mail -s postfix-log e-mail-cím
cat /etc/fstab | mail -s postfix-log e-mail-cím
Mit csinál?
A /root/pfstat legeneráldik?
Üdv:
TT
Igen, elküldi rendben, a /root/pfstat fájl 644 és a root-é.
Bálint István
2014/1/9 Takacs Tibor taka...@ntszki.hu
Van egy linux-script:
#!/bin/bash
pflogsumm -d yesterday /var/log/mail.log /root/pfstat
cat /root/pfstat | mail -s postfix-log e-mail-cím
cat /etc/fstab | mail -s
Bocs, én úgy gondoltam, ha beteszed a cron-ba:
cat /etc/fstab | mail -s postfix-log e-mail-cím
akkor megjön a fstab?
Igen, elküldi rendben, a /root/pfstat fájl 644 és a root-é.
Bálint István
2014/1/9 Takacs Tibor taka...@ntszki.hu
Van egy linux-script:
#!/bin/bash
Megoldottam, de magyarázatot nem tudok rá:
A /var/spool/cron/crontab/root fájlt crontab -e -vel hoztam létre. Így
hiányosan futott le.
Áttettem a /etc/crontab-ba - ugyanazt a sort, csak hozzáírta, a root-ot -
így lefut.
Bálint István
2014. január 9. 15:03 Takacs Tibor írta, taka...@ntszki.hu: